What is a Residential Remodeling Contractor?
A residential remodeling contractor is a professional who specializes in the renovation or remodeling of residential properties. This includes everything from simple cosmetic updates to extensive home transformations. Whether you're planning to add a new room, update your kitchen, or completely overhaul your home's layout, a remodeling contractor is the key to achieving your vision.
These experts manage the day-to-day aspects of a project, from obtaining permits to coordinating with subcontractors and ensuring that the work is completed on time and within budget. The best residential remodeling contractors have extensive experience, strong project management skills, and the ability to bring creative ideas to life.

How to Find the Right Residential Remodeling Contractor
Choosing the right residential remodeling contractor for your custom home remodel can be a challenge, but it’s essential for the success of your project. Here are some tips for finding the perfect contractor:
1. Do Your Research
Start by researching potential contractors in your area. Look for those who specialize in custom home remodels and have experience with projects similar to yours. 2. Check Credentials
Make sure that the contractor is licensed, insured, and bonded. This provides protection for both you and the contractor in case of accidents, mistakes, or property damage. Ask to see their credentials and verify their reputation with local licensing boards.
3. Ask for a Portfolio
A professional residential remodeling contractor will have a portfolio of past work that showcases their capabilities. Look for before-and-after photos, client testimonials, and descriptions of similar projects they’ve completed. This will give you a better understanding of their style, attention to detail, and overall quality of work.
4. Get Multiple Estimates
It’s always a good idea to get estimates from at least three contractors before making your decision. This gives you a better idea of the costs involved and helps you evaluate the scope of work each contractor is offering. Remember, the cheapest option isn’t always the best choice – quality should be your top priority.
5. Communicate Clearly
Good communication is key to a successful custom home remodel. Make sure you’re comfortable with the contractor’s communication style and that they’re willing to listen to your ideas and concerns. A collaborative approach ensures that your vision is brought to life.
